A 35-year-old man named Musa Abdulai, suspected of aiding bandits in Ekiti State by supplying them with food items, has been arrested. The arrest occurred on Monday, October 7, 2024, around 6:30 pm in Ise Ekiti, as reported by Officer Adeleye Abiodun, Head of the Communications Department of the Ekiti State Amotekun Corps.
Abdulai, originally from Sokoto State and residing in Shasha, Akure, Ondo State, was apprehended by Amotekun Operatives from the Ise-Ekiti Local Government Command during a patrol at Oritan Forest Reserve in Ise/Orun. He reportedly confessed to delivering food supplies to individuals believed to be Fulani/Bororo bandits hiding in the area.
A sack containing food items was recovered from him at the scene. The suspect has been handed over to the Divisional Police Station in Ise Ekiti for further investigation.
